Maruti Suzuki's car despatches rise 35% YoY to record 242,688 units in May

MUMBAI – Maruti Suzuki India Ltd. Monday said it sold a record 242,688 automobile units to dealerships in India and abroad in May, up 35% on year but only a percent more on month. This includes domestic sales of 200,774 vehicles, up 35% on year and exports of 41,914 units, up 34%. 

 

Maruti Suzuki sold 190,337 passenger vehicles in May, up 40% on year. This includes sales of 16,275 mini cars in May, compared to 6,776 units sold a year ago. Models sold by the company in this segment include the Alto and S-Presso.

 

The despatches of its compact and mid-size cars grew 32% on year to 81,555 units in May. Models in this segment include Baleno, Celerio, Ciaz, Dzire, Ignis, Swift, and WagonR. Combined, the company sold 97,830 passenger cars in May, up 42% on year. Maruti Suzuki also sold 13,240 Eeco vans to dealerships in India in May, up 7% on year. 

 

The Gurugram-based automaker sold 3,198 light commercial vehicles in May, up 17% on year but down 6% on month. Maruti Suzuki sold 7,239 passenger vehicles to other carmakers in May, down 29% on year and nearly 15% on month. 

 

APR-MAY

Maruti Suzuki has sold 482,334 cars in 2026-27 (Apr-Mar) so far, up 34% on year. Domestic sales by the company has grown 33% on year to 400,366 units while exports have risen nearly 39% to 81,968 units. Despatches of its utility vehicles in Apr-May have grown 38% on year to 157,159 units.

 

For the March quarter, Maruti Suzuki's net profit was INR 35.91 billion on revenues of INR 524.49 billion. At 1203 IST, shares of the company traded 0.7% lower at INR 13,030 on the National Stock Exchange.   End
